根据planType来查询可添加人员列表
GET
/coursePlanDetail/getPersonnelListByType
根据planType来查询可添加人员列表
请求参数
Authorization
在 Header 添加参数
Authorization
,其值为在 Bearer 之后拼接 Token示例:
Authorization: Bearer ********************
Query 参数
current
integer <int64>
当前页码
默认值:
1
示例值:
1
size
integer <int64>
分页大小
默认值:
20
示例值:
20
column
string
排序字段
示例值:
id
asc
boolean
排序规则
默认值:
true
示例值:
true
planType
integer
必需
planDetailId
integer <int64>
可选
planPostType
integer
可选
personnelName
string
人员姓名
personnelPhone
string
人员手机号
personnelType
integer
可选
vehicleBrand
string
车牌号
示例代码
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request GET 'http://127.0.0.1:9000/coursePlanDetail/getPersonnelListByType?current=1&size=20&column=id&asc=true&planType=&planDetailId=&planPostType=&personnelName=&personnelPhone=&personnelType=&vehicleBrand='
返回响应
🟢200成功
application/json
Body
records
array[object (PlanDetailPersonResp) {5}]
可选
id
integer <int64>
从业人员id
personnelName
string
人员姓名
personnelPhone
string
人员手机号
personnelType
integer
可选
vehicleBrand
string
车牌号
total
integer <int64>
可选
size
integer <int64>
可选
current
integer <int64>
可选
orders
array[object (OrderItem) {2}]
可选
column
string
可选
asc
boolean
可选
optimizeCountSql
boolean
可选
searchCount
boolean
可选
optimizeJoinOfCountSql
boolean
可选
maxLimit
integer <int64>
可选
countId
string
可选
pages
integer <int64>
可选
示例
{
"records": [
{
"id": 0,
"personnelName": "",
"personnelPhone": "",
"personnelType": 0,
"vehicleBrand": ""
}
],
"total": 0,
"size": 0,
"current": 0,
"orders": [
{
"column": "",
"asc": false
}
],
"optimizeCountSql": false,
"searchCount": false,
"optimizeJoinOfCountSql": false,
"maxLimit": 0,
"countId": "",
"pages": 0
}